## Approval: Driver-Assignment Heuristic

The Routewise dispatcher assigns drivers using a weighted score of proximity, shift remaining, and recent cancellation rate. Changes to the weights, the tie-breaking rule, or the fairness cap require a documented approval before deployment to the Harborfield region. Maintainers should attach simulation results from the Fleetbench harness and note any expected change in average pickup time. All approvals are recorded on this page, and final sign-off rests with the person named below.

named custodian: Zorok Briir Novvan

## DeployBot Quick Reference — Support Team

DeployBot is the little helper in our #releases channel that answers "is staging broken?" so you don't have to ping the platform crew. If it goes quiet, first check that the Relay worker is running, then restart the bot pod — it usually comes back within a minute. No luck? Escalate to on-call infra. Before escalating, grab the current config values shown below and include them in your ticket.

settings of fafog-haduf:
ZORIX_PIN=4648
ZORIX_METRICS_HOST=metrics.zorix.paliqsys.corp
ZORIX_LOG_LEVEL=info
ZORIX_TENANT=druix

Context: lockouts on the Pinefold admin console are now recoverable without restarts. The Emberline config daemon watches the auth overrides file and hot-reloads within five seconds. Procedure: on-call writes a temporary recovery override, daemon picks it up, operator resets the account, override is deleted, daemon reloads again. No pods cycle; sessions persist. Audit events land in the Tarrow log. Open item for the sync: override TTL default. The override file is unlocked with the recovery passphrase noted below.

unlock words, fafop-hawep: briwyn-oliix-sorox

## Gateway Rate Limits

The Cobblewick gateway enforces per-client token buckets: 200 req/s default, burst 500. Limits live in the routes manifest; don't hardcode overrides. 429s include a retry-after header — honor it. Need a higher quota for load tests? Request it before running anything. Quota approvals go through the platform team.

escalation mailbox, yajeg-bageg: quenax.olidor@lumiccorp.internal